Analysis
In 2025, number of local breeds with unknown risk status in Viet Nam stood at 61. That is the highest value across all 26 years on record.
The figure is up 74.3% over ten years.
Over the whole period, number of local breeds with unknown risk status in Viet Nam peaked at 61 in 2020 and was at its lowest, 3, in 2000.
Viet Nam ranks 6th of 20 regions on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Number of local breeds with unknown risk status in Viet Nam, year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2000 | 3 | — |
| 2001 | 4 | +33.3% |
| 2002 | 5 | +25.0% |
| 2003 | 5 | +0.0% |
| 2004 | 5 | +0.0% |
| 2005 | 6 | +20.0% |
| 2006 | 34 | +466.7% |
| 2007 | 54 | +58.8% |
| 2008 | 54 | +0.0% |
| 2009 | 54 | +0.0% |
| 2010 | 30 | -44.4% |
| 2011 | 30 | +0.0% |
| 2012 | 31 | +3.3% |
| 2013 | 31 | +0.0% |
| 2014 | 31 | +0.0% |
| 2015 | 35 | +12.9% |
| 2016 | 35 | +0.0% |
| 2017 | 35 | +0.0% |
| 2018 | 35 | +0.0% |
| 2019 | 35 | +0.0% |
| 2020 | 61 | +74.3% |
| 2021 | 61 | +0.0% |
| 2022 | 61 | +0.0% |
| 2023 | 61 | +0.0% |
| 2024 | 61 | +0.0% |
| 2025 | 61 | +0.0% |
